A tension control bolt (TC bolt) is a heavy duty bolt used in steel frame construction. The head is usually domed and is not designed to be driven. The end of the shank has a spline on it which is engaged by a special power wrench which prevents the bolt from turning while the nut is tightened. When the appropriate tension is reached the spline shears off.{{Cite web | url=https://lejeunebolt.com/lbc/wp-content/uploads/2016/07/howthetcboltworks.pdf | title=Tension Control Bolts | website=lejeunebolt.com}}
